The flyweights were worn, that is, there is a hole in the fly weight that fits on a pin. I guess these suckers rotate on this pin a bit? As rpms increase, the rotate a more due to centrifugal force? Forgive me as I am new to this stuff. Anyway these holes were egg shaped , or if you prefer a technical term, wallered out. A spring on one of the flyweights broke and caused all kinds of problems in there.
A walk through the yellow pages found a local indy shop that had Drag Specialties part number DS-242115 in stock.
